JESUS THE APOLLO unveils “IRV! (Symphony of The Shadow Self)”


With "IRV! (Symphony of The Shadow Self)," Manchester, UK-based artist JESUS THE APOLLO guides us through a place where spiritualism, sound design, and self-discovery meet. The single doesn’t sound much like a regular song, it reminds us more of a guided trip into some back part of the mind.

The whole song was done by JESUS THE APOLLO from writing & composing to producing, even mixing! It demonstrates original creative vision. "IRV!" was recorded in a home studio, one that gives the recording an immediate sense of intimacy, apparently by design, as if the listener were being allowed into a secret ritual rather than shown a shiny performance. What gives the song so much emotional and philosophical heft is how close it is. Rather than presenting darkness as something to be feared, the song embraces it and promotes a process of recognition and integration. The concept is also apparent in the pitch-bent effects on voices that alternate between the familiar and the freakish. The result is a ghostly environment that is as eerie as it is restful.

The music also draws on a strong spiritual core, blending gnostic and Buddhist concepts. These influences don’t hijack the song, they subtly shape its mood and mission, leaving listeners to interpret the journey as they please. It’s music that rewards quiet, thoughtful listening and gets better with each listen.

"IRV! (Symphony of The Shadow Self)" by JESUS THE APOLLO proves that deep thoughts don’t have to be difficult, they have to be simple, clear, and inventive. This is a powerful record from an artist who’s not afraid to dig deep for balance, meaning, and truth.
